Natalia Bakaeva’s education has given her the skills and hands-on training that allows her to provide her students with the best teaching practice possible. She received her master's degree in French Linguistics from the University of Toronto in 2008 and continued her education in the field of Sociolinguistics, which granted her a Doctorate in French Linguistics in 2016.

Over the past 10 years, she has put her knowledge to work as a researcher and course instructor at the University of Toronto. Her teaching specializations are Linguistics and French as a Second Language.

Natalia’s teaching focuses on developing linguistic proficiency, cultural competence and peer interaction through blended teaching in French. Her passion for cross-cultural understanding is illustrated in her beliefs and approaches to teaching, where diverse student needs are placed at the forefront of learning processes.
